Batteries The most vital component of any key fob is the battery. It's what allows you to unlock your car and then start it. As time passes the battery will eventually be depleted to the point where you'll require replacement. The lifespan of your Porsche key fob battery depends on many factors. It is based on how often you use it as well as the location you live in. The majority of people will get between three and four years from a brand new battery. If the battery in your Porsche key fob begins to fail, you might notice that the buttons on the remote do not function as well. This is a signal that your key fob requires a new battery. You may also find that your keys aren't functioning at all. If you're unable to lock or unlock your doors, open the trunk or set off the panic alarm on your key remote, it's the time to purchase a new battery. To change the battery, you must take your key fob from the door lock and flip it to the back. To remove the key, push the release button located at its bottom. Then pull the key apart from the rest. Once your key fob is removed, carefully take out the old CR 2032 3 Volt Lithium battery by moving the plastic containing clip back. After that, put in the new CR2032 3 Volt Lithium battery, making sure that they are facing the right direction. Once the batteries are installed, you can start testing the battery on your vehicle.
